Travel Insurance Can Save the Day, or at Least the Dough

Most people buy travel insurance to reimburse themselves for plane fares and other costs if an unforeseen event, such as a medical emergency, forces them to cancel an expensive vacation. But most policies also provide coverage for unfortunate events that happen during your trip. For example, most insurance policies provide a 24 hour hotline that customers can call to rebook flights, make hotel arrangements or find ground transportation.

Ten Commandments of Group Travel Buying

Yield-management computers slice and dice the demand for travel so finely that prices now differ substantially depending on the date, the day of the week and even the hour you travel. Shifting your travel plans by a few days or even a few minutes can mean substantial savings.

Are You Ready for the Smerfs?

The SMERFs, a hardy and growing bunch, are traveling in groups for Social, Military, Education, Religious, and Fraternity reasons, offering vast untapped potential for this regions developing and recovering travel markets.
